JK觸發(fā)器是一種重要的數字電路元件,廣泛用于計數、寄存器和數據存儲等數字系統(tǒng)中。它由JK輸入端、時鐘輸入端、清零端(復位、RD)和置位端組成。本文將詳細介紹JK觸發(fā)器的基本功能,以及它的RD和SD端的功能。
JK觸發(fā)器是一種雙翻轉電路,可以存儲一位數據。它由兩個輸入端(J和K)、一個時鐘輸入端(CLK)、一個輸出端(Q)和一個反向輸出端組成(Q?)組成。與SR觸發(fā)類似,JK觸發(fā)器通過控制輸入信號來實現數據的存儲和翻轉,但它克服了SR觸發(fā)的固有缺陷,即當S和R都為1時的特別狀態(tài)。
JK觸發(fā)的狀態(tài)轉換規(guī)則如下:
J = 0, K = 0:保持狀態(tài)(輸出Q不變)
J = 0, K = 1:復位(Q = 0)
J = 1, K = 0:置位(Q = 1)
J = 1, K = 1:翻轉(Q取反)
通常帶有兩個額外的控制端:清零端(Reset,RD)和置位端(Set,SD)。這兩個端口提供了額外的控制功能,使得觸發(fā)的應用更加靈活和多樣化。
清零端(RD)
也稱為復位端,通常標記為RD或R。其主要功能是強制將觸發(fā)的輸出Q設為0,無論其他輸入信號的狀態(tài)如何。當清零端被激活時,觸發(fā)器立即進入復位狀態(tài),輸出Q為0,Q?為1。
RD = 0:觸發(fā)(Q = 0)RD = 1:正常操作(受控于J和K輸入信號)
清零端通常為低電平有效的信號,這意味著當RD信號為0時,觸發(fā)被復位。當RD信號為1時,觸發(fā)正常工作,受J和K輸入信號控制。
置位端(SD)
也稱預置端,通常標記為SD或S。其主要功能是強制將觸發(fā)的輸出Q設為1,無論其他輸入信號的狀態(tài)如何。當置位端被激活時,燃燒立即進入置位狀態(tài),輸出Q為1,Q?為0。
SD = 0:資產負債(Q = 1)SD = 1:正常操作(受控于J和K輸入信號)
置位端同樣通常是一個低電平有效的信號,這意味著當SD信號為0時,觸發(fā)器被置位。當SD信號為1時,觸發(fā)器接收到J和K輸入信號控制。
清零端和置位端的綜合作用:
清零端和置位端通常優(yōu)先級為J和K輸入信號及時鐘信號,這意味著無論J和K輸入信號及時鐘信號的狀態(tài)如何,一旦RD或SD被激活,立即觸發(fā)相應的狀態(tài)轉換。這種設計使得觸發(fā)器可以在任何時刻被強制復位或置位,提供了靈活的控制手段。
由于其靈活的功能和可靠的性能,廣泛評估各種數字電路和系統(tǒng)中。以下是一些典型的應用場景:
計數器:在計數器設計中,JK觸發(fā)器常用于實現二進制計數器。通過適當連接J和K輸入信號,可以實現加法計數器、減法計數器或任意進制的計數器。
登記數據:JK觸發(fā)可以初始化數據初始化,用于存儲和傳輸數據。在這種應用中,觸發(fā)的置位和復位功能可以用來初始化初始化的狀態(tài)。
狀態(tài)機:在有限狀態(tài)機(FSM)設計中,JK觸發(fā)用于存儲和控制狀態(tài)。通過組合多個觸發(fā)和邏輯門,可以實現復雜的狀態(tài)轉換和控制功能。
JK觸發(fā)器是數字電路中的重要元件,其基本功能是通過J和K輸入信號及信號時鐘實現數據的存儲和翻轉。清零端(RD)和置位端(SD)為觸發(fā)器提供了額外的功能的控制功能,使得觸發(fā)器可以在任意時刻被強制復位或置位。這些特性使得JK觸發(fā)器在計數、數據登記和狀態(tài)機等應用中具有廣泛的用途。了解JK觸發(fā)器的功能和rd和sd端功能,有助于設計和實現更加復雜和可靠的數字系統(tǒng)。